Two new Huawei handsets launched today in India. The Huawei U8300 and U8500 are two Android-touting 3G smartphones powered by Qualcomm chipsets. The U8300 skews towards the younger, social media friendly crowd with it’s loud color scheme and interesting form factor. A full QWERTY keyboard below a touchscreen display is reminiscent of the Blackberry-esque styling of the Motorola Charm. Throw in the bright colors and we are looking at a phone that appears to be Huawei’s take on the Charm mixed with the Motorola FlipOut.
The U8500 is a stylistic departure from the U8300, and along with a more traditional form ditches the a physical keyboard. Exact specs on the phone remain scant for now.
